(1990) Bergeijk, Peter Adrianus Gerrit van
This thesis explores the relevance and possibilities of an approach which takes political circumstances explicitly into account in explaining international trade.
Chapter 1 discusses the need for renewed interest in political influences that shape the world economic system. Although the merits of specialization have to be acknowledged, it appears that no substantial arguments exist for the presently very strict demarcation between foreign policy and trade theory. ...
